The 6 dB Attenuator Pad by Holland Electronics is a compact, nickel-plated inline device designed to reduce signal strength by 6 decibels. Compatible with a wide range of coaxial devices including antennas, HDTVs, and satellite receivers, it effectively eliminates signal overload and buzzing, ensuring optimal picture quality across frequencies from 5 MHz to 3 GHz. These are very accurate, and brought my downstream power to my modem down exactly 6dBmV. Ended up getting a 10db one, too, as that's what I needed to get my levels perfect. But I didn't know if it would overcorrect it, so I went with the 6 at first. My advice would be to get the one that is exactly how much you need, as they do exactly what they state.

HDHomerun - solved signal quality issues TV tuner
My OTA antenna was providing a strong signal over powering the HDHomerun tuner and resulting in poor signal quality on two stations. I purchased a 3db and 6db attenuator. The 6db was all I needed to solve the problem and get my signal quality back to perfect. Easy and cost effective solution.

Helps sometimes
I have a digital TV antenna (no cable) and was getting pixelation on one channel, while a couple of other channels weren't received at all. I am not that far from the broadcasting towers (maybe 30 miles or so). I got the attenuator because I had read that a signal too strong could cause the pixelation. I attached the 6db attenuator and the picture and audio came in nice and clear. I thought this solved my problem but there are still times when I get pixelation again. I do, however, now usually get the two channels that I couldn't previously receive. Overall things are better but not perfect. I also got 3db and 10db attenuators but they didn't help at all. When I attach those there is no picture or sound.
